Maximizing Your eSIM Connectivity
Want to improve your eSIM connection ? Several straightforward tips can assist you increase your mobile rate . First, ensure your handset has the current software releases; older software can negatively affect functionality. Next, examine your copyright's data coverage in your region; a limited signal will always lead to reduced download rates . Finally, test restarting your phone ; this can often resolve temporary problems influencing your eSIM connection . Consider trying different data settings if provided by your device for further improvement .
eSIM Speed Assessment vs. Conventional SIM: What Is Faster ?
The debate surrounding eSIM speed and legacy SIM card throughput is frequently asked by users . Generally, embedded SIMs themselves don't inherently offer a significant edge in raw data transmission speed compared to a traditional SIM. The bottlenecking factor is typically the cellular infrastructure and the operator's capabilities . However, some eSIM implementations might experience slightly lower latency due to the elimination of the physical SIM interface, potentially resulting in a perceptible improvement in responsiveness in certain conditions. In conclusion , both versions of SIM cards are bound by the network capacity , and a true speed disparity is unlikely unless additional factors are at play, such as signal strength.
